Does Blooming Grove’s population show that my firm will receive demand?+
No. The 2020–2024 ACS estimates Blooming Grove’s population at 18,635, with a margin of error of 60. Population is eligibility or geographic context only; it does not prove search demand, competition, leads, cases, or revenue.

Will creating many Blooming Grove pages guarantee visibility?+
No. Google says scaled content needs original value, accuracy, and relevance, and that automation does not guarantee crawling, indexing, or search visibility. A page should exist because it serves a real information need and accurately represents your firm.
What should my firm prepare before discussing AI SEO?+
Prepare your confirmed practice areas, attorney and firm details, geographic coverage, existing website access information, and the questions your attorneys are willing to address. Also decide what your firm considers a qualified inquiry and how intake records source information.
How should we judge whether AI SEO is working?+
Separate observations into stages: whether an engine cites or mentions the firm, whether someone visits or calls, whether the inquiry fits the firm’s criteria, and whether the matter progresses.
